Households in refugee-hosting communities become self-reliant

[The Observer - Uganda] - 21/08/2024
In the Rwamwanja refugee settlement, Kamwenge district, over 10,000 poor refugee and Ugandan households have transitioned from conditions of food insecurity and fragile livelihoods to self-reliance and resilience. The AVSI foundation, with funding from the USAID Office of Food for Peace, has (...)
